AMBRICAN-5 contains ambrisentan, a selective endothelin receptor antagonist used in the treatment of p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H). The medication works by relaxing pulmonary blood vessels, reducing vascular resistance, and lowering strain on the right side of the heart.

Ambrisentan has been extensively evaluated in international clinical trials, including the ARIES-1 and ARIES-2 studies. Clinical data demonstrated improved six-minute walk distance, delayed disease progression, and enhanced quality of life in patients with PAH. The drug showed effectiveness both as monotherapy and in combination treatment regimens.
The medication is indicated for the treatment of pulmonary arterial hypertension. It is used to improve physical activity tolerance, reduce disease symptoms, and slow the progression of pulmonary vascular changes. Ambrisentan blocks endothelin activity, helping prevent narrowing of pulmonary arteries and elevated pulmonary pressure.
The medication is taken orally as prescribed by a healthcare professional, usually once daily with or without food. Tablets should be swallowed whole with water. Dosage and duration of treatment depend on the patient’s condition and therapeutic response.
